Brighton’s West Pier Collapses Amid Storm Claudio Fury!
This morning, storm-lashed Brighton saw part of its iconic West Pier crumble into the sea. The brutal weather brought on by Storm Claudio battered the coast despite the Met Office’s yellow warning officially ending at 8 am on Tuesday.
Storm Claudio’s Wrath Hits Sussex Hard
Even after the official warning ended, severe weather has relentlessly pounded Sussex throughout the day and into the evening of November 2nd. Winds and waves showed no mercy, leaving damage in their wake.
Historic Landmark Takes a Beating
The once-grand West Pier, already weakened by years of decay, finally gave way under nature’s assault. Locals and visitors watched in shock as sections of the pier collapsed, swallowed by the furious sea.
